Thank Your Vet Contest Begins in June

Dog owners can nominate their veterinarian to be recognized as one of America’s best.

Posted: May 23, 2008, 5 a.m. EDT

Is your vet the best around? Help him be recognized as one of America’s best. Morris Animal Foundation is looking for America’s best veterinarian with its second annual Thank Your Vet for a Healthy Pet Contest.

The nationwide essay contest, which runs from June 1 to Aug. 31, is sponsored by Hill’s Pet Nutrition and CAT FANCY and DOG FANCY, published by BowTie Inc., and the corresponding websites CatChannel.com and DogChannel.com.

Submissions can be no longer than 300 words and should address four areas:

  • The veterinarian’s outstanding care and treatment of clients.
  • Commitment to the human-animal bond.
  • Service to the community.
  • Devotion to the veterinary profession.

“Last year’s contest was a huge success with more than 1,000 nominations submitted,” says Patricia Olson, DVM, Ph.D., president and chief executive officer of Morris Animal Foundation. “We are delighted that Hill’s Pet Nutrition has joined us this year as the official corporate sponsor. We are also very pleased to have the BowTie publications returning as our media sponsors. We received many nominations last year from their readers.”
